Can XSL handle large and small numbers specified in 1e-157 or 1.1e+12 notation. Results of numerical comparisons (greater than, less than) seem pretty random using this format. The xpath recomendation states that all numbers are treated as double-precision 64-bit format IEEE 754 value and points to a description of this that I can't totally get to grips with.
